1 O God, my heart is steadfast; I will sing and give praise, even with my glory.
2 A wake, lute and harp! I will awaken the dawn.
3 I will praise You, O Lord, among the peoples, And I will sing praises to You among the nations.
4 F or Your mercy is great above the heavens, And Your truth reaches to the clouds.
5 B e exalted, O God, above the heavens, And Your glory above all the earth;
6 T hat Your beloved may be delivered, Save with Your right hand, and hear me.
7 G od has spoken in His holiness: “I will rejoice; I will divide Shechem And measure out the Valley of Succoth.
8 G ilead is Mine; Manasseh is Mine; Ephraim also is the helmet for My head; Judah is My lawgiver.
9 M oab is My washpot; Over Edom I will cast My shoe; Over Philistia I will triumph.”
10 W ho will bring me into the strong city? Who will lead me to Edom?
11 I s it not You, O God, who cast us off? And You, O God, who did not go out with our armies?
12 G ive us help from trouble, For the help of man is useless.
13 T hrough God we will do valiantly, For it is He who shall tread down our enemies.
